Select first (affects all extensions) - When checked (default), a selection can be made with the

right mouse button instead of displaying the extension-specific menu. When this is not checked, se-
lect menu items by clicking and dragging the mouse.

Begin/End pairs - Specify the begin/end pairs to use for the selected extension in a format similar to a

regular expression. This text box is unavailable for languages that have special begin/end matching
built-in. See

Begin/End Structure Matching

for more information about begin/end pairs and using this

option.

Word chars - The word characters affect the operation of all word-oriented commands, including word

searching. You can use a dash (-) character to specify a range, such as "A-Z", which specifies upper-
case letters. To specify the dash ( -) character as a valid word character, place a dash at the beginning
or end of the word character string.

Auto-Complete Tab

Auto-Complete options in SlickEdit

®

Core can be configured for each file extension type. To access these

options, click Window

Preferences, expand SlickEdit and click General in the tree, then double-click

the File Extension Setup setting. On the Extension Options dialog, select the Auto-Complete tab.
